设H(x)是一哈希函数,有K个不同的关键字(x1,x2,x3...xk)满足H(x1)=H(x2)=...=H(xk).若用线性探测法将这K个关键字存入哈希表中,至少要探测( )次。 |
单选 |
从未排序的序列中依次取出一个元素与已排序序列中的元素进行比较,然后将其放在已排序序列的合适位置上,该排序方法称为( )。 |
单选 |
在数据结构中,逻辑上数据结构可分为( )。 |
单选 |
在一个单链表HL中,若要在指针q所至结点的后面插入一个指针p所指向的结点,则执行( )。 |
单选 |
栈和队列的共同点是( )。 |
单选 |
列举出四个常用的排序算法(),(),()和() |
问答 |
数据结构中评价算法的两个重要指标是()和() |
问答 |
分析下面算法(程序段)该该算法的时间复杂度为() |
问答 |
回答下面问题 |
问答 |
一个图的()表示法是唯一的,而()表示法是不唯一的。 |
问答 |
在对一组记录(54,38,96,23,15,72,60,45,83)进行直接插入排序时,当把第7个记录60插入到有序表时,为寻找插入位置需比较()次。 |
问答 |
在堆排序和快速排序中,若原始记录接近正序或反序,则选用(),若原始记录无序,则最好选用() |
问答 |
表达式A+((B*C-D)/E+F*G/H)+I/J的后缀表达式是() |
问答 |
设正文串长度为n,模式串长度为m,则串匹配的KMP算法时间复杂度为() |
问答 |
对于一棵具有n个结点的二叉树,若一个结点的编号为i(1≤i≤n),则它的左子结点的编号为(),右子结点的编号为(),双亲结点的编号为() |
问答 |
请指出三个稳定和三个不稳定的内部排序法。 |
问答 |
回答下面问题 |
问答 |
用克鲁斯卡尔算法将下列的图构造成最小生成树,画出生成过程。 |
问答 |
不使用乘号,除号,for,while及问号表达式实现1+2+3+…+N |
问答 |
将算术表达式((a+b)+c*(d+e)+f)*(g+h)转化为二叉树。 |
问答 |